And note the "lone" sideways boot print just in front of Hitchcock. It has caused much ado in the Aulis and Jack White camps. Apparently it has more treads than a normal print and therefore has to have been "placed by a whistleblower."

See Jack White's post of Jan 25 2005, 09:58 PM on page 5:
http://educationforum.ipbhost.com/in...showtopic=2632

Never mind that a hi-res version shows other "sideways" boot prints and that this one is probably two prints superimposed, and particularly don't take any notice of the 16mm film showing Neil Armstrong walking sideways to take the TV camera out to its position. He did this to avoid becoming entangled with the coiled cord which bobbed around and caused problems in the 1/6th gravity.
